Getting There

  • Metro

    Start your journey by taking the Kyiv Metro. If you are near the city center, find the nearest metro station and take Line 1 (Red Line) towards 'Syrets' station. Travel for approximately 5 stops and get off at 'Hydropark' station. Once you exit the metro, follow the signs towards the park area.

  • Walking

    After exiting 'Hydropark' station, head east towards 'Hydropark' and walk along the bank of the Dnipro River. Continue walking straight for about 15-20 minutes. You will pass various recreational areas. Keep walking until you reach the bridge that leads to the Dniprovs'kyi District.

  • Public Transport

    Alternatively, from 'Hydropark' station, you can take a bus or tram. Look for bus number 60 or tram number 14. Board the bus or tram, and ride for about 10-15 minutes until you reach the stop called 'Kniazia Romana Mstyslavycha Street'.

  • Walking

    After getting off at 'Kniazia Romana Mstyslavycha Street', walk a short distance (about 200 meters) down the street. The Border Defenders Monument is located at Kniazia Romana Mstyslavycha St, 7, and will be on your right. Look for the large monument which is a significant historical landmark.
